Description

Sharp's was founded in 1994 and within 15 years had grown from producing 1,500 barrels a year, to 60,000. It was bought by Molson Coors in 2011. Heavy investment has brought the capacity up to 200,000 barrels a year. The company owns no pubs and delivers beer to more than 1,200 outlets across South England via temperature-controlled depots in Bristol and London. Part of Molson Coors PLC.

Champion Beer Of Britain Award

The Champion Beer of Britain is one of the most prestigious beer competitions in the world. It is the ultimate honour for UK brewers and has helped put many into the national spotlight.

Judging for the competition takes around a year, starting with individual nominations from CAMRA members and tasting panel nominations, leading to a series of rigorous regional heats adhering to a strict blind tasting policy.
